Nakiri

The nakiri is one of the oldest, most continuously use knives in Japan. It's a simple, double-bevel, rectangular blade. The name essentially translates to "vegetable knife" and it's great for that use and not so great for everything else. The nakiri has bee na staple of the Japanese kitchen for hundreds of years and reflects the importance of vegetables in Japanese cooking.
